Summit Vantage on Prospect Mountain
The tour culminates with a run to the summit of Prospect Mountain where riders are rewarded with wide views of the Rockies and Leadville's Historic Mining District from above.
Meadow Time and Easy Trails
After an initial familiarization, the route opens onto gentle trails and a meadow area set aside for freer riding and basic maneuvers—designed for enjoyment rather than technical challenge.
High-Altitude Departure from Birdseye Outpost
The experience begins at roughly 10,000 feet at Birdseye Outpost, setting a high-altitude context for the entire two-hour loop.
What the day feels like
What the Two Hours Feel Like
The outing is a compact progression: a short, on-site training, then guided riding on easy trails with a stretch of open meadow for play, and finally an ascent to Prospect Mountain’s summit—delivered in an efficiently paced two-hour window that requires no prior snowmobile experience.

How long is the tour?
The tour is two hours in duration.
Do I need prior snowmobile experience?
No—no prior experience is required; the outing begins with on-site training.
Where does the tour start?
The tour operates from Birdseye Outpost, at roughly 10,000 feet near Leadville, Colorado.
What will we see on the ride?
Riders ascend Prospect Mountain for views of the Rockies and Leadville's Historic Mining District, with time on easy trails and a meadow for freer riding.
Who runs this tour?
The tour is operated by High Country Tours.
